All Characters, All Chaos
In this remix, players have access to every character introduced across both Italian Brainrot entries—but with no restrictions. That means swapped vocals, broken timings, cross-character echoes, and remixed personalities all appear at once. You’re not just building one sequence—you’re managing dozens of conflicting rhythms and avatars in real-time. Every move has layered consequences, especially when certain characters trigger passive effects that destabilize loops across the board.
- Massive Avatar Grid: More than double the usual lineup size, with no forced structure or sequencing order.
- Interference Mechanics: Characters may disrupt neighboring sounds or even suppress entire rows.
- Reactive Loop Physics: Some sounds fade in and out depending on others being active, leading to partial silences or bursts of noise.

Multiphase Modes and Beat Collapse Challenges
To manage the overload, the game introduces multiphase remix modes where players must survive wave-based instability. Each round changes the rules: in one phase, looping gets disabled after a set time; in another, sound output becomes random unless anchored by stabilizer avatars. There’s also a remix collapse challenge—where you build toward a climax sequence knowing the grid will self-destruct at the end.
- Survival Remix: Maintain a working beat across five instability phases.
- Disruption Ladder: Each level adds new interference mechanics—from voice warping to avatar lockouts.
- Collapse Finale: Build a rhythm before the grid implodes—only sustained loops remain.
